Facilities and Amenities at Howwood Station

Howwood station caters to the basic needs of travelers with a modest setup. Be mindful that there's no ticket office on site, and ticket machines aren't available, so you'll need to purchase your tickets in advance or make alternative arrangements. However, the station does feature a smartcard validator for those using smart travel cards, enhancing the convenience of frequent travelers. An induction loop is available for hearing assistance, ensuring an inclusive travel experience for those with hearing impairments. While there are no staff present to assist, informational support is accessible via customer help points, and timely travel announcements are regularly made.

Parking is straightforward, with 30 car spaces, including two designated Blue Badge spaces. Charging for parking is not applicable here, making it an advantageous facility for travelers wishing to leave vehicles. For those who cycle, there are 10 bicycle stands. However, car park and bike storage areas lack CCTV coverage, so security measures should be taken by passengers to secure their belongings.

Step-free access is partially available, with ramps leading to both platforms. However, travelers are advised to exercise caution due to noticeable gaps between the platform and trains, especially on platform 1. Although there are no waiting rooms, there is a designated seating area for comfort while you await your train.

Onward Travel Options

If you're wondering about onward travel, not to fret, Howwood station offers connectivity beyond the rail tracks. Information about Rail Replacement Services and local bus services is readily available. Buses conveniently operate from Station Road, providing handy transport links during rail disruptions. Meanwhile, taxis can be booked through www.traintaxi.co.uk, ensuring you can always reach your final destination hassle-free. For detailed routes and schedules for bus services, visitors can check Travel Line Scotland or call their 24-hour service for assistance.
